Gnome UI Standard



A lot of people have a lot of different opinions about how something
should be done.  (ie - icons vs. menus; location of help menu; options
vs. preferences; etc.)  I had a thought about overall system design.
It seems that when some people write programs they want to do it their
way and not conform.  Well I think most people would agree that is bad
for the Gnome project.

I propose that only applications which meet the Gnome UI Standard,
which has yet to be defined, should be included in Gnome.  Any
application using GTK but not meeting the Gnome UI Standard will not
have the privilege of being included in the default Gnome
installation.  Maybe there should be a Gnome UI test which each GTK
application would have to meet before being included with Gnome.
